They're actually a really good but balanced class. Excellent soloing that requires next to no gear, and they are a versatile group class with boatloads of utility. Their raid role is lacklustre, however.

It's more that Enchanter, Shaman and Bard are overpowered classes, and outstrip the Necromancer at his soloing, grouping and raiding capabilities.

Woah woah woah, Necro is a fine raiding class. DA training and bone walking are high value and high skill. Twitches, corpses summons and the occasional rez are great as well.

They are a much better play maker in ToV than those other classes you listed and solid in VP. Meanwhile, Shamans, Enchanters and Bards do a lot of wall licking. A heads up Ench/Bard can do some work, though. Shaman? We have enough of those. Please log to your rogue, thanks.
